Ripley's Believe It Or Not Museum
Description
The odd and unusual displays inside this museum are not the only thing that draws visitors to see this place. The building itself is one of the most photographed buildings in the world. Why? Because it is cracked. It was built this way to represent the strongest earthquake in the United States, which occurred in 1812 here in Missouri. Inside, you will find displays of the weird and unusual findings of Robert Ripley, who scoured the world for strange places, people and events.
